DJI-NEW YORK, May 28 (Reuters) - U.S. stocks ended lower on Friday, capping off their worst month in over a year as Fitch Ratings' downgrade of Spain's credit rating reignited worries about euro-zone debt issues.
The Dow and the S&P 500 registered their worst monthly percentage losses since February 2009. Based on the latest available data, the Dow Jones industrial average <.DJI> fell 122.36 points, or 1.19 percent, to end unofficially at 10,136.63. The Standard & Poor's 500 Index <.SPX> was down 13.65 points, or 1.24 percent, to finish unofficially at 1,089.41. The Nasdaq Composite Index <.IXIC> was down 20.64 points, or 0.91 percent, to close unofficially at 2,257.04.

FCPO-JAKARTA, May 27 (Reuters) - Indonesia's palm oil exports in April fell 15.6 percent from a year ago because of a higher export tax and sluggish demand from Europe, the Indonesian Palm Oil Association (GAPKI) said on Thursday.
Indonesia exported 1.028 million tonnes of palm oil and its by-products in April, compared to 1.218 million tonnes in the same period last year, Gapki said in a statement.
REGIONAL EQUITIES-BANGKOK, May 27 (Reuters) - Southeast Asian markets gained on Thursday as investors looked for bargains among cheaply valued shares and positive sentiment in commodity markets spurred demand for energy and resource sectors.
Sentiment in the region turned more positive as the euro recovered on Thursday after comments from a Chinese official calmed some concerns that the country may be distancing itself from euro zone debt holdings.
